More about Certificate III in Marine Mechanical Technology

The Certificate III in Marine Mechanical Technology is an excellent pathway for individuals in Tamworth looking to build a successful career in the marine industry. This qualification covers essential skills and knowledge that can lead to various job roles such as Marine Mechanic, Electrical Technician, and Service Technician. With the growing demand for skilled professionals in the marine sector, obtaining this certification can greatly enhance your employability in Tamworth and beyond.

Training providers such as Kangan Institute and TAFE NSW offer convenient online delivery modes for the Certificate III in Marine Mechanical Technology, making it easier for local students to access quality education without the need to travel far. The skills acquired from these accredited courses are transferrable to various related fields, including Transport and Logistics, Trades, and Information Technology, ensuring that you receive a well-rounded education that meets industry standards.

Graduates of the Certificate III in Marine Mechanical Technology can also explore various other career paths, such as Small Engine Mechanic, Parts Interpreter, and even a Sales Assistant role within the maritime or automotive sectors.
